Changelog 3.9.1 — Deep-link Key Rotation (Wrenfold Mobile). As part of hardening the Atlastrail deep-link router, we rotated the credential used to sign routing manifests after the old one exceeded its age policy. All manifests published before this release remain valid until the grace window closes. New team members publishing manifests should configure their tooling with the rotated key shown below.

rollout seal: bky4_yke3

- [ ] Step 7: Archive cold storage buckets (Glacierline tier). Confirm both ceremony witnesses are present, verify bucket manifests match the Oxbow ledger, then seal the archive key shares. Plugin authors may observe but not handle shares. Once sealed, the archive index itself is encrypted and can only be reopened with the passphrase below.

vault phrase of badup-hahig = tamael-aldael-kelmir-istael-fenok-istwyn-tamius-jorath-oliion

The garage occupancy feed for the Brindlewood campus arrives over a message queue every thirty seconds, one record per level, published by the Stallgrid edge boxes. Counts can briefly go negative when a sensor double-fires on exit; the ingest job clamps these to zero and flags the interval. If the feed stalls for more than five minutes, the dashboard falls back to the last known snapshot. Sensor mappings, queue names, and the replay procedure are documented on the internal page below.

runbook for tahog-kadug: https://gitlab.qirvanworks.corp/projects/pages/view/b139298aed28

**Runbook: Migrating off QueueBarn**

Reviewer notes: this change swaps the homegrown QueueBarn dispatcher for the managed Relayline broker. Verify that retry semantics remain at-least-once and that dead-letter routing preserves the original enqueue timestamp. Both paths run in shadow mode for one week before cutover. The shadow comparison job records its build token below.

build token for kagaf-hahof: htk14_9d3d4d26d7d8de